Understanding Wallet Recovery
Wallet recovery processes are essential for catering to unforeseen circumstances such as loss or theft of keys. These flows typically involve verifying the user's identity alongside securely reinstating access to their assets. The delicate balance of creating efficient recovery mechanisms while protecting user data is where many companies falter. In particular, not sufficiently addressing user privacy concerns can lead to diminished trust, ultimately impacting user engagement and platform stability.
The Role of KYC in Wallet Recovery
Know Your Customer (KYC) processes have been a focal point for most digital financial platforms to comply with regulations. While KYC is beneficial for minimizing fraud, it can also deter users who value their privacy. Compliance must not come at the expense of user experience or transparency.

Implementing Two-Factor Authentication
Integrating two-factor authentication (2FA) into wallet recovery spells out an additional layer of security. By combining something users possess (e.g., a mobile device) with something they know (e.g., a password), the risk of unauthorized access diminishes. Given recent findings on account security concerns, creating interfaces that emphasize the necessity and benefits of 2FA can transform recovery flows into more robust processes.
Using Smart Contracts for Automated Recovery
Incorporating smart contracts can further fortify wallet recovery flows. Smart contracts can automate recovery actions based on predefined conditions, eliminating the human element prone to error and misuse. End-to-End Encryption
Application of end-to-end encryption ensures that only the intended recipients can access specific user data. By encrypting sensitive information in transit and at rest, companies can provide users with peace of mind, knowing their data is shielded from unauthorized access. Data Minimization Principles
Following data minimization principles involves collecting only the data that is necessary for wallet recovery processes. Techniques like double-blind verification and opacity in data storage can reassure users while abiding by KYC compliance regulations.
